POSITION OVERVIEW – The primary function of the Sales Specialist is to provide coordination, sales enablement, and administrative support to Channel Sales initiatives, and partner programs related to software and solutions offerings.

RESPONSIBILITIES
●    Support channel enablement activities through coordination of training sessions, administrative coordination, pipeline tracking, and opportunity follow-up
●    Assist with scheduling and coordination of sales reviews, partner meetings, and sales enablement sessions.
●    Prepare sales reports, pipeline summaries, dashboards, and business review materials.
●    Coordinate follow-up actions from customer meetings, partner discussions, and internal sales reviews.
●    Help maintain backlog/order tracking, CRM updates, and opportunity status reporting.
●    Assist with software migration coordination and partner onboarding activities
●    Support channel enablement initiatives by organizing training materials, presentations, and documentation.
●    Facilitate communication between internal teams and channel partners regarding ongoing projects and support requests.
●    Contribute to partner adoption initiatives and operational support programs related to Software and Solutions offerings.
●    Assist with gathering market feedback, customer requests, and partner activity updates for internal reporting purposes.
●    Coordinate administrative support activities for pilot programs, partner initiatives, and sales operations processes.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S/SKILLS
●    Bachelor's degree in marketing or equivalent training required.
●    5-7 years of experience required.
●    Verbal and written communication skills, negotiation skills, customer service and interpersonal skills.
●    Ability to work independently and manage one's time.
●    Basic mentoring skills necessary to provide support and constructive performance feedback.
●    Knowledge of principles and methods for showing, promoting, and selling products or services.
